>Description:

	The databases/p5-BerkeleyDB has been marked broken for ${OSVERSION} < 500000 due build errors
>How-To-Repeat:
	Try to compile it on FreeBSD 4.11
>Fix:

	Just replace 
BROKEN= ...
with 
USE_GCC=        3.4+
